Abstract

The study aims to know the perspective of the Dasmarinas persons with disability on the implementation of expanded benefits and privileges as presented in RA 10754 by means of quantitative analysis, particularly using weighted mean, percentage, ranking, frequency distribution, ANOVA, and T-test to interpret the results of the data. The study was conducted in the City of Dasmarinas, Cavite, specifically in Barangay Zone II, III, and IV, Barangay Sta. Lucia, Barangay Burol 1 and 2 and Barangay Salitran III and IV, having 73 persons with disability as the respondents of the study. The group distributed several copies of the 36-item survey questionnaire to different barangays and were given to the respondents of the study to answer. The results showed that DPWDs is very aware on the parts of the law financial incentives, educational assistance, and other benefits and privileges. Furthermore, there is a significant difference as to the interaction to the law when respondents are grouped according to their type of disability. This indicates that depending on their type of disability, respondents have a varying degree of interaction to the programs of the law. Moreover, DPWDs always observe the efforts of the government such as the establishment of the express lane, educational assistance, and social participation. finally, the respondents strongly agreed on the impact the law made as to their health and environment, however, there was a lesser degree of agreement on the impact of the law as to their finance and education. Nevertheless, the respondents of the study report that the law have positively impacted their lives, thereby, DPWDs have a positive perspective as to the implementation of RA 10754.
